  • Initial Brief:

    • Discussion with the client to understand needs, preferences and budget.

    • Gathering information about the desired style, functionalities and constraints.

  • Research and Inspiration:

    • Creating a moodboard with reference images, colors and styles.

    • Analysis of current trends and technical specifications.

  • Measurements and Space Evaluation:

    • On-site visit for precise measurements.

    • Assessment of the existing structure and potential limitations.

  • Conceptualization:

    • Sketching the initial layout and design proposals.

    • Creating a space plan and furniture sketch.

  • Design Development:

    • Creation of 2D and 3D plans.

    • Selection of materials, furniture and accessories.

  • Design Presentation:

    • Presenting the design proposal to the client, including realistic images and moodboards.

    • Collecting feedback and making necessary adjustments.

  • Implementation:

    • Coordination of construction, renovation and layout works.

    • Supervision of furniture assembly and decorative details.

  • Final Styling:

    • Adding final accessories and making detailed adjustments.

    • Preparing the space for delivery to the customer.

  • Project Submission:

  • Providing the completed project to the client.

    • Ensuring that all details are in line with initial expectations.
